Phillips 66 to close Los Angeles refinery at end of 2025

Phillips 66, one of the largest independent oil refining companies in the US by market capitalization, has announced the closure of its Los Angeles refinery at the end of 2025.

Report informs citing Interfax that, according to the American company's statement, this refinery, built more than a hundred years ago, accounts for 8% of all oil refining capacity in California.

The closure will affect about 600 company employees and 300 contractors working at the facility.

The decision to cease operations at the refinery is due to market uncertainty, the press release states.
